Half of the gilts were injected with PG600\u00ae at 153 days of age, and half were left as controls. Gilts were bred, weaned, and some were reassigned as nurse sows. After 1 or 2 weanings, sows were randomly assigned for another treatment of PG600\u00ae. The results show the first treatment group of\u00a0PG600\u00ae had larger litters, but the same number weaned between groups. PG600\u00ae increased the percent of sows bred within 8 days of weaning from 66% to 85%.\u00a0As well, nurse sows had larger next litters, and an increased percent bred within 8 days of the second weaning.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>The method and results for a project looking at the effect of hormone induction of puberty in gilts on longevity and performance.
